Driveway Pavers Replacement Questions
What are common reasons to replace a driveway paver? Replacement is often needed due to cracking, uneven surfaces, or extensive wear that affects safety and appearance.
How can I tell if my driveway pavers need replacement? Signs include loose or shifting pavers, visible damage, or significant staining that cannot be cleaned.
What types of driveway pavers are suitable for replacement projects? Options include conc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ers, chosen based on durability and style preferences.
What should property owners consider before replacing driveway pavers? It’s important to evaluate the existing foundation, drainage, and overall design to ensure a long-lasting result.
